Rhamnus frangula

Alder Buckthorn; Alder Dogwood; Arrow Wood; Black Dogwood; Dog Wood; European Buckthorn; Frangula Bark; Glossy Buckthorn

The berries of Rhamnus frangula are not exactly poisonous but are uneatable, since if swallowed they cause vomiting. Of course this is individual and different individuals react differently, but no human fatalities are documented. ...
